A 53-year-old Chinese man was arrested on Wednesday (9 August) after he was spotted flying a drone within the restricted zone designated for the National Day Parade (NDP).

According to a police statement, the man was seen committing the act at the Marina Barrage at 3.01pm. The man’s drone was also seized by the police.

Under the Public Order Act, the area surrounding the Marina Bay Platform – where the NDP was held – was declared a Special Event Area for the whole of Wednesday. This meant that no Unmanned Aerial Vehicles or drones were allowed within the restricted zone.

Police investigations into the matter are ongoing. If convicted, the man could be jailed for up to 12 months, fined up to $20,000, or both.
